Commodities in the limelight

  • Published 26 Nov 2009

Interest in China equities bounced back in the last two weeks with China's energy and material sectors in particular seeing record inflows.

Flows to China's energy and materials sector equities saw record inflows last week hitting $116.3m (Rmb 795m, €77.8m, £70.3m) and $98.3m respectively. Dollar weakness, and how best to cope with it, has dominated in recent weeks helping commodity sector funds come into the spotlight, said EPFR senior analyst Cameron Brandt.
